The Lismore Hotel Eau Claire - A Doubletree By Hilton
44.81151, -91.49972The 4-star Lismore Hotel Eau Claire - A Doubletree By Hilton is just an 8-minute walk from Paul Bunyan Logging Camp Museum and offers a cash machine and a lift. Featuring a swimming pool, this business hotel is only a short drive from natural sights like Owen Park.
Location
Mount Washington is at a distance of 3.4 km from the property, which also stands a mere 5 minutes' walk from Valleybrook Church. The local Chippewa Valley Museum is at a distance of 2.5 km from the Lismore Hotel Eau Claire - A Doubletree By Hilton Eau Claire, and Chippewa Valley Regional airport is 10 km away. The accommodation is also within walking distance of Chippewa Valley. The Lismore Hotel Eau Claire - A Doubletree By Hilton is situated adjacent to Riverview Park, while Eau Claire Transit Transfer Center bus station lies nearly 5 minutes' walk away.
Rooms
This Eau Claire property features 112 rooms with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as tea and coffee making facilities. They are outfitted with comfortable decor.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ided in the restaurant. The à la carte Informalist restaurant in this Eau Claire hotel offers dishes for brunch. The onsite bar has a lounge and is decorated with an open fireplace. You can visit a restaurant situated close by and taste Asian cuisine.
Leisure & Business
At the Lismore Hotel Eau Claire - A Doubletree By Hilton, guests can also benefit from fitness classes provided at a gym facility.
